Serum-and glucocorticoid-regulated kinase 1 (Sgk1) contributes to Na+ reabsorption in the
aldosterone-sensitive distal nephron. Sgk1-knockout (sgk1−/−) and littermate wild-type mice
(sgk1+/+) were used to test the importance of Sgk1 in renal elimination of K+. Intravenous
application of K+ load under anesthesia increased plasma K+ concentration by 1.3 to 1.4
mM in both sgk1−/−(n= 6) and sgkl+/+(n= 7) mice. However, the increase of absolute and
